    6.1 
    RS-232 Connection and 
    Port Configuration
    To interface the VHD Controller with a home theater automation/control system or a PC 
    running terminal emulation software, connect it to your control system or PC as shown in 
    Figure 3-14. 
    Configure the RS-232 controller or PC serial port as follows: no parity, 8 data bits, 1 stop bit 
    and no flow control. Set the baud rate to 19200, to match that of the VHD Controller RS-232 
    port. 
    6.2 
    Serial Command Syntax
    Serial commands to the VHD Controller take the following form:
     Commands are not case-sensitive. 
     For a single command that takes no parameters, type the command followed by a 
    carriage return; for example, to set the aspect ratio to Letterbox, type 
    LETTERBOX
     . 
     For a single command that takes a parameter, type the command, a space or a comma 
    and the desired value followed by a carriage return; for example, to set the brightness to 
    -10, type BRIGHTNESS
     -10  or BRIGHTNESS,-10 . 
     You can also send a string of multiple commands on a single line, separated by commas. 
    For example, COMPOSITE,BRIGHTNESS
     100,ANAMORPHIC  switches to 
    the Composite video input, sets the brightness to 100 and sets the aspect ratio to 
    Anamorphic. Command strings can be up to 255 characters long. 
     
    Table 6-1 lists the RS-232 command set. The “Parameter (min/max)” column shows the valid 
    parameter ranges, or “NA” for commands that take no parameters. 
    When you enter a valid command, the VHD Controller executes it and acknowledges it with a 
    plus sign on the command line (+ >). When you enter an invalid command – one that is 
    misspelled or followed by values outside the valid range for that command – the VHD 
    Controller ignores it and returns a minus sign (- >). 
    6Serial Communications
    Avoid combining the ON or POWER 1 commands with other commands on a 
    single line. After sending ON or POWER 1, allow at least 15 seconds for the 
    VHD
     Controller to power up. Once it does, it will accept and properly execute 
    multiple serial commands.

    Brightness and Contrast: Cinema Standards Measurement System (CSMS) 
    Specifications
    - Brightness: 102.0 foot-Lamberts (fL) 
    - Contrast Ratio (variable, based on lens aperture setting):  
    224:1 - 275:1
    These measurements are taken from the projector in a controlled, home 
    theater environment. All measurements are made to ANSI/NAPM 
    IT7.228-1997 specifications using the Photo Research PR-650 
    SpectraColorimeter and Minolta LS-100 Luminance Meter, Video 
    Essentials test DVD and a 1.3 gain, 72-inch wide screen. The projector is 
    calibrated to a color temperature of 6,500K and has a minimum of 150 
    hours of usage.
    The foot-Lambert (fL) is the unit of measurement used in commercial 
    movie theaters to express image brightness at the screen surface. The 
    Society of Motion Picture and Television Engineers (SMPTE) specifies 
    16
     fL as the target image brightness for film-based projectors using an 
    open gate (without film in the projector). More importantly, today 
    SMPTE specifies 12
     fL as the target image brightness in Digital Cinema 
    theaters. The foot-Lambert measurement is dependent on screen size, 
    screen gain and projector light output.
    Home Theater Calibration Specifications
    - Light Output: 3517 ANSI Lumens
    - Contrast Ratio (variable, based on lens aperture setting):  
    224:1 - 275:1
    These specifications are obtained by calibrating the projector as 
    described above for CSMS measurements. 
    Industry-Standard Specifications
    - Light Output: 6000 ANSI Lumens
    - Contrast Ratio (variable, based on lens aperture setting): 
    1500:1 - 2000:1
    These are typical projector brightness and contrast specifications found 
    in most companies’ sales literature. Vidikron includes these 
    measurements in its literature to allow for direct comparison with other 
    manufacturers’ projectors. These measurements are typically taken at 
    9,000K to 13,000K to get expected performance data when the projector 
    is used in professional, commercial and industrial displays.
